Book Description

February 1, 1979
Ken Talley, a Vietnam vet who lost his legs in combat, lives in a farmhouse in rural Missouri with his lover, Jed. Traumatized and bitter, Ken struggles to find meaning in his life. As he contemplates selling the farmhouse, old friends and family members descend for a vacation. A bittersweet portrait of the rock n roll generation at the precise moment they realize the fireworks ended yesterday.

About the Author

Lanford Wilson is the author of the full length plays BALM IN GILEAD. THE RIMERS OF VELDRITCH (Vernon Rice Award), THE GINGHAM DOG, LEMON SKY, SERENADING LOUIE, THE HOT BALTIMORE (New York Drama Critics Circle Award; Best American Play, Obie Award), ANGELS FALL (Tony nomination) and many more. He has been inducted into the Missouri Writers Hall of Fame and the American Theatre Hall of Fame. Wilson is a founder (with Tanya Berezin, Rob Thirkield, and Marshall W. Mason) of the Circle Repertory Company in New York City and was a resident playwright there from 1969-1995. About L.A. Theatre Works: L.A. From AudioFile

Without scenery and the physical expressions of the actors, the time-specific setting of this play prevents an easy transition from staged performance to recording. Without the props and set to support the tone, the characters do not fully develop. Wilson's characters are hard to like, making the character of Gwen excessively shrill when there is nothing but her voice to express her motivations. Area microphones on the stage rather than body microphones on the actors create an uneven volume. Lines delivered off-stage are excessively muted. The recording's lack of separate tracks is a disadvantage in returning to specific points in the play. While I am not typically a play reader, I do love to go to the theatre. Growing up, my father exposed my brother and me to a wide variety of plays, from musicals to dramas, one-acts to Shakespeare and Wilde, Miller and Williams, but I have a hard time reading them. Maybe it's the lack of description, although I would hate to think I disliked something because it actually forces me to think for myself, to create the set and the costumes, the props. With novels and short stories, even biographies, the backgrounds are usually detailed so completely, the visions pop into my head without a second thought. That said, 5th of July by Lanford Wilson, allows an easy interpretation for the reader. I didn't expect to be able to get through it so quickly. I feared that I would be bogged sown by the dialogue, but instead was happily surprised, discovering a relatively easy read, both harmonious and moving in scope.

Set in a farmhouse in Missouri, the play depicts a scant cast of characters, each of whom holds his or her lost dreams, misconceived notions about the world and buried resentments. The unlikely mix of characters includes the following: a handicapped, gay Vietnam veteran; his gardening-obsessed lover; his elderly aunt (and her dead husband's ashes); an eccentric husband and wife; a musician. A simple plot allows Wilson to develop each of these characters fully, engrossing the reader in their twisted world.

While I would still rather see a play than read one, I'll now blame that on the atmosphere at the theatre, the buzz in the air, the majesty of the sets and the costumes, the sometimes brilliance of the actors. I won't shy away from reading plays any longer; I'll read others by Wilson, I'll be fascinated by Wilde (I'm positive), and I'll even give Shakespeare another shot.
